MotoGP rider Marquez to undergo surgery after crash

By Emre Asikci

ANKARA (AA) – Spanish MotoGP rider Marc Marquez will undergo surgery on his broken right arm following a heavy crash during the Spanish Grand Prix on Sunday.

"Sometimes things don't go as you expect but the most important thing is to get back up and move on. I hope you enjoyed the comeback! Now I'll have an operation to fix the fracture of my right humerus. I promise you all that I will come back as soon as possible and even stronger," Marquez said on Twitter.

The reigning world champion crashed hard on the lap 22 and ended the race with four laps to go.

"We'll hopefully see Marc Marquez back on track at the Gran Premio Red Bull de Andalusia on Friday the 24th of July," MotoGP said on its website.
